TANZANIA: More than 40 illegal immigrants arrested, charged in Mwanza

Written by MOSES MATTHEW in Mwanza.


 A TOTAL of 42 illegal immigrants in Mwanza Region have been arraigned in court for staying in the country illegally and in some cases, some few were ordered to legalise their status.

The Mwanza Regional Immigration Officer, Ms Anna Yondani told the ‘Sunday News’ in Mwanza city  that 42 illegal immigrants have been nabbed for the period of January to April, this year. “Those who were charged at the court are from Congo-DRC, Kenya, Burundi, Rwanda, Ethiopia, Uganda, Cameroon, America and India,” she said.

She said that among those who were arraigned were 10 women and 32 men, adding that regional immigration offices continue with efforts to control this influx. She added that the alleged illegal immigrants have changed the system of entering the country, after the government recently introduced a new tight system to control illegal immigrants.

She noted that the lake zone regions have become a new route used by the illegal immigrants who have been arriving from Kenya using Sirari border through Tarime, Mwanza Region to Mbeya where it is easy for them to cross to Zambia and Malawi up to South Africa.
